The Two Faces of Abdominal Fat: Subcutaneous vs. Visceral

Before we dive into why belly fat is so challenging, it's important to understand that not all fat around your midsection is created equal. There are two primary types, each with distinct characteristics and health implications.

The first type is subcutaneous fat, which is the soft, pinchable fat located just beneath your skin. This is the fat you can see and feel, and while excessive amounts are generally undesirable, it's less metabolically active and poses fewer immediate health risks compared to the second type. Subcutaneous fat can be found all over the body, including the abdomen, hips, and thighs.

The more concerning type, and often the primary culprit behind a "hard to lose" belly, is visceral fat. This deep abdominal fat surrounds your internal organs, including the liver, pancreas, and intestines. Unlike subcutaneous fat, visceral fat is highly metabolically active, meaning it releases inflammatory molecules and hormones that can significantly impact your health. High levels of visceral fat are strongly linked to an increased risk of type 2 diabetes, heart disease, certain cancers, and other chronic conditions.

Visceral fat also has a higher density of specific fat receptors (alpha-2 adrenergic receptors) that inhibit fat breakdown, and fewer receptors (beta-2 adrenergic receptors) that promote fat release. This unique receptor profile makes it inherently more resistant to being mobilized and burned for energy, even when you're in a calorie deficit. This is a key reason why it feels so stubborn.

The Hormonal Tug-of-War: Why Your Body Clings to Belly Fat

Beyond the specific characteristics of visceral fat cells, a complex hormonal environment often dictates where your body stores and releases fat. Several key hormones play a significant role in making belly fat particularly stubborn.

💪

Cortisol: The Stress Hormone

Chronic stress is a major contributor to stubborn belly fat. When you're stressed, your body releases cortisol. While essential for fight-or-flight responses, chronically elevated cortisol levels signal your body to store fat, specifically in the abdominal region. Cortisol also increases appetite and cravings for high-calorie, sugary foods, creating a vicious cycle that makes fat loss incredibly difficult. Managing stress is not just good for your mind, but crucial for your waistline.

🍯

Insulin: The Fat Storage Regulator

Insulin is vital for regulating blood sugar, but chronically high insulin levels, often due to diets high in refined carbohydrates and sugars, can lead to insulin resistance. When your cells become resistant to insulin, your pancreas produces more to compensate, leading to a state of hyperinsulinemia. High insulin levels promote fat storage, especially visceral fat, and inhibit fat burning. Improving insulin sensitivity is a cornerstone of effective belly fat loss.

👩

Estrogen & Testosterone: Sex Hormones

The balance of sex hormones also plays a role. In women, particularly during menopause, declining estrogen levels can lead to a shift in fat distribution from hips and thighs to the abdomen. In men, lower testosterone levels can also be associated with increased abdominal fat. Maintaining healthy hormonal balance through diet, exercise, and lifestyle is important.

💫

Leptin & Ghrelin: Appetite & Satiety

These two hormones regulate hunger and fullness. Leptin signals satiety, while ghrelin stimulates appetite. Imbalances, often caused by poor sleep or chronic overeating, can lead to leptin resistance, where your brain doesn't receive the "full" signal, leading to increased food intake and fat storage. Optimizing these hormones is key for appetite control and metabolic health.

Beyond Hormones: Other Factors Making Belly Fat Stubborn

While hormones are significant players, several other factors contribute to the persistence of abdominal fat, making it a multifaceted challenge.

Genetics: Unfortunately, genetics can influence where your body preferentially stores fat. If your parents or close relatives tend to carry weight around their midsection, you might be predisposed to the same pattern. However, genetics are not destiny; they simply mean you might need to be more diligent with your lifestyle choices.

Age: As we age, our metabolism naturally slows down, and we tend to lose muscle mass. Muscle is more metabolically active than fat, so less muscle means fewer calories burned at rest. Hormonal changes with age also contribute to increased abdominal fat storage, particularly visceral fat.

Lack of Sleep: Poor sleep quality and insufficient sleep duration are strongly linked to increased belly fat. Sleep deprivation disrupts the balance of appetite-regulating hormones like leptin and ghrelin, leading to increased hunger and cravings. It also elevates cortisol levels, further promoting abdominal fat storage. Aim for 7-9 hours of quality sleep per night.

Sedentary Lifestyle: A lack of physical activity is a primary driver of fat accumulation, especially around the waist. Regular exercise not only burns calories but also improves insulin sensitivity and reduces chronic inflammation, both crucial for combating belly fat. Dietary Choices: While often obvious, the impact of diet cannot be overstated. Diets high in refined sugars, unhealthy trans fats, and processed foods contribute to inflammation, insulin resistance, and overall fat gain, particularly in the abdominal area. Even seemingly healthy options can be problematic if portions are too large or if they contain hidden sugars.

What Actually Works: A Holistic Approach to Losing Belly Fat

Given the complex nature of belly fat, a single magic bullet doesn't exist. Instead, a comprehensive, multi-faceted approach that addresses diet, exercise, lifestyle, and potentially targeted supplementation is key. Here's what actually works:

1

Prioritize a Whole-Foods, Nutrient-Dense Diet

Focus on reducing processed foods, sugary drinks, and refined carbohydrates. Instead, fill your plate with lean proteins (chicken, fish, legumes), healthy fats (avocado, nuts, olive oil), and plenty of fiber-rich fruits and vegetables. Fiber is particularly important as it promotes satiety, aids digestion, and helps stabilize blood sugar, directly impacting insulin levels. A diet rich in these components naturally reduces inflammation and supports metabolic health.

2

Incorporate Smart Exercise: Strength & HIIT

While cardio is good for calorie burning, it's not the most effective strategy for targeting stubborn belly fat alone. Combine strength training 2-3 times a week to build muscle mass, which boosts your resting metabolism. Add high-intensity interval training (HIIT) sessions, which are proven to burn more fat and improve insulin sensitivity more effectively than steady-state cardio. This combination creates a powerful fat-burning synergy.

3

Master Stress Management Techniques

Remember cortisol's role? Actively managing stress is non-negotiable for belly fat loss. Incorporate practices like meditation, deep breathing exercises, yoga, spending time in nature, or engaging in hobbies you enjoy. Even short, consistent periods of stress reduction can significantly lower cortisol levels and create a more favorable environment for fat loss.

4

Optimize Your Sleep Environment and Habits

Aim for 7-9 hours of quality sleep per night. Create a dark, cool, and quiet bedroom environment. Establish a consistent sleep schedule, even on weekends. Avoiding screens an hour before bed and limiting caffeine/alcohol intake can significantly improve sleep quality, which in turn helps regulate hormones that impact appetite and fat storage.

5

Stay Hydrated and Limit Sugary Drinks

Water is essential for every bodily function, including metabolism and fat burning. Often, thirst is mistaken for hunger, leading to unnecessary snacking. Drink plenty of water throughout the day. Crucially, eliminate sugary sodas, fruit juices, and energy drinks, which are major sources of empty calories that contribute directly to visceral fat accumulation.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why is belly fat so much harder to lose than fat in other areas?

+

Belly fat, especially visceral fat, contains a higher density of alpha-2 adrenergic receptors, which inhibit fat breakdown, and fewer beta-2 receptors, which promote it. This makes it metabolically less responsive to fat-burning signals. Hormonal factors like cortisol and insulin also play a significant role in its persistence.

Can stress really contribute to increased belly fat?

+

Yes, chronic stress leads to elevated cortisol levels. Cortisol not only signals the body to store fat, particularly in the abdominal region, but it can also increase appetite and cravings for high-calorie, comfort foods, creating a vicious cycle that makes belly fat harder to lose.

Are there specific types of exercise that are most effective for targeting belly fat?

+

While spot reduction isn't possible, a combination of high-intensity interval training (HIIT) and strength training has shown to be highly effective. HIIT boosts metabolism and burns more calories post-workout, while strength training builds muscle mass, which increases resting metabolic rate and helps burn fat overall.

How important is diet in losing stubborn belly fat?

+

Diet is paramount. Focusing on whole, unprocessed foods, ample protein, fiber, and healthy fats is crucial. Reducing refined carbohydrates, sugary drinks, and excessive unhealthy fats can significantly impact belly fat. A calorie deficit, achieved through mindful eating, is essential, but the quality of calories also matters for hormonal balance.
